Definitions
Mile (mi)
A mile is a unit of length in the Imperial and United States customary systems of measurement. It is primarily used in the United States and the United Kingdom. Historically, the mile has varied in length, but it has been standardized as:
- 1 mile = 1.609344 kilometers
Kilometer (km)
A kilometer is a unit of length in the International System of Units (SI), commonly known as the metric system. It is widely used around the world for expressing distances between geographical places on land.
- 1 kilometer ≈ 0.621371 miles
Understanding the Relationship Between Miles and Kilometers
The key to converting miles to kilometers lies in the exact relationship established between these two units:
- 1 mile = 1.609344 kilometers
- 1 kilometer ≈ 0.621371 miles
This precise definition allows for accurate and consistent conversions between the Imperial and metric systems.
Conversion Formulas
From Miles to Kilometers
To convert miles to kilometers, multiply the number of miles by 1.609344.
- Kilometers = Miles × 1.609344
From Kilometers to Miles
To convert kilometers to miles, divide the number of kilometers by 1.609344.
- Miles = Kilometers ÷ 1.609344
Alternatively, multiply the number of kilometers by 0.621371.
- Miles = Kilometers × 0.621371
Step-by-Step Conversion Process
Example 1: Convert 50 miles to kilometers
- Identify the conversion formula:
Kilometers = Miles × 1.609344
- Plug in the value:
Kilometers = 50 × 1.609344
- Calculate:
Kilometers = 80.4672
- Conclusion:
50 miles is equal to 80.4672 kilometers.
Example 2: Convert 120 miles to kilometers
- Apply the formula:
Kilometers = 120 × 1.609344
- Calculate:
Kilometers = 193.12128
- Conclusion:
120 miles is equal to 193.12128 kilometers.

Athletic Event
A marathon is 26.219 miles long. To find out the distance in kilometers:
- Apply the formula:
Kilometers = 26.219 × 1.609344
- Calculate:
Kilometers ≈ 42.195
- Conclusion:
The marathon is approximately 42.195 kilometers long.
Conversion Tables
Miles to Kilometers
Miles (mi) | Kilometers (km) |
---|---|
1 | 1.609344 |
5 | 8.04672 |
10 | 16.09344 |
20 | 32.18688 |
50 | 80.4672 |
75 | 120.7008 |
100 | 160.9344 |
150 | 241.4016 |
200 | 321.8688 |
250 | 402.336 |
300 | 482.8032 |
400 | 643.7376 |
500 | 804.672 |
Kilometers to Miles
Kilometers (km) | Miles (mi) |
---|---|
1 | 0.621371 |
5 | 3.10686 |
10 | 6.21371 |
20 | 12.42742 |
50 | 31.06856 |
75 | 46.60284 |
100 | 62.13712 |
150 | 93.20568 |
200 | 124.27424 |
250 | 155.3428 |
300 | 186.41136 |
400 | 248.54848 |
500 | 310.6856 |
